Abstract

Aortic dissection is associated with high morbidity and mortality rates. Mortality is 1-2% per hour in the first 24 hours after the onset of symptoms; and, without surgery, 90% of patients die within the first 3 months. Patients who receive a proper emergency treatment show a hospital mortality rate ranging from 15 to 30%.
